About Belton
Belton is a mid-sized Missouri city in terms of public-school footprint, with 8 schools and 4,230 students total.
For a sense of the school types, the city comprises 5 elementary, 2 middle, and 1 high.
Per-campus enrollment runs near 529, above the state mean of about 382.
Looking at the last 7 years. Total public-school enrollment in Belton has fell 13% since SY 2017-18, moving from about 4,868 students to 4,230. The school count fell from 9 to 8 across the same 7-year window. Demographically, the White share of enrollment contracted from 68% to 59%.
